With all the roof styles and designs that you can pick in the market today, you most likely require a little aid to press you to the right instructions. Proper planning and considerable time should be allocated in picking the best roof style that would best fit your home. roofings greatly contribute to the look you desire your home to illustrate.
In thinking about timeless roofing designs, you'll possibly find the variety practically endless. Timeless roofing often needs a considerable amount of craftsmanship and competence. That is why aside from picking premium grade materials, it is equally essential to employ only the finest roof professionals in your location.
There are a lots alternatives to the classic roofing frequently discovered in archetypal homes. Frequently, the usage recycled roof products are perfectly suitable to help you in achieving the classic roofing design to wish to pull off. It is also advisable to utilize the light-weight, synthetic products if you like the standard, traditional roof design.
traditional roof products frequently utilized frequently can not hold up against high winds and other extreme weather components as effectively as synthetic materials. There are steel tiles which are created to look like traditional roofing tile but with the advantage of easier installation and considerably more affordable too. Synthetic roof materials are available in numerous designs and textures that you can choose from to attain the look you seek for your roofing system. The synthetic classic roof will not just provide you the protection and coverage against severe weather conditions, you can with confidence expect it to last longer than the basic cedar or slate roofing systems.
There are numerous more recent slates and replica shakes that are actually filled with rubber substances, making it capable to better inhibit the harmful UV rays, and more resilient and fire resistant. Artificial materials are significantly much easier to set up using air pressured nail weapons.
Be sure to evaluate the benefits of every alternative when first deciding the style of roof to wish to adapt. Choose which design that will best boost the appeal of your house, and would still use the sturdiness that you require.

Flat roofings are an excellent way to keep a structure safe from water. Understanding exactly what to do with a flat roof will guarantee you have a working roof system that will last a long time.
may look excellent, and are really common, flat roofings do need routine upkeep and in-depth repair work in order to effectively prevent water seepage. You'll be happy with your flat roofing system for a very long time if this is done properly.
Flat roofings aren't as glamorous and/or popular as its more recent counterparts, such as tile, copper, or slate roofing systems. Nevertheless, they are simply as crucial and require much more attention. In order to avoid getting rid of money on short-term repair work, you must understand exactly how flat roofing systems are developed, the various kinds of flat roofings that are readily available, and the value of regular evaluation and upkeep.
A flat roof system works by offering a waterproof membrane over a structure. It consists of several layers of hydrophobic materials that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is generally put between the roofing and the deck membrane.
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, converge with the membrane and the other structure elements to prevent water infiltration. The water is then directed to drains, downspouts, and gutters by the roofing system's slight pitch.
There are 4 most common kinds of flat roof systems. Noted in order of increasing toughness and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, multiple-ply or built-up,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is used over and existing roofing system, to $20 per square foot or more for new metal roofs.
Utilized considering that the 1890s, asphalt roll roof typically includes one layer of asphalt-saturated natural or fiberglass base felts that are used over roofing fel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and typically covered with a granular mineral surface area. The seams are normally covered over with a roof substance. It can last about 10 years.
Single-ply membrane roof is the newest type of roof product. It is frequently used to replace multiple-ply roofs. 10 to 12 year service warranties are common, however proper setup is vital and maintenance is still needed.
Multiple-ply or built-up roof, likewise known as B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or layered felts or mats that are sprinkled with layers of bitumen and appeared with a granular roof tile, sheet, or ballast pavers that are used to safeguard the underlying materials from the weather. BURs are designed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the products utilized.
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a finish of asphalt or coal tar. Since the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es inspecting and keeping the joints of the roofing hard.
Flat-seamed roofings have been used since the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last numerous years depending on the quality of the exposure, product, and upkeep to the components.
Galvanized metal does need routine painting in order to avoid corrosion and split joints need to be resoldered. Other metal surfaces,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and usually needs changing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less-steel are preferred as long-lasting flat roofs.
